Another couple of CJ's. First is a stamp CJ which I decided looked very Indian, hence Rani Warrior Queen of India. I used alcohol inks, gold stamp pads, Judikins cube Indian stamps and the main stamp with diamond glaze on it. There are several gold Indian stamps on the background which don't show very well in the photograph but are clearer in real life.
